Hi Guys,

Where I am I don't have access to HVAC specialist :) like you do in US.

I'm thinking about upgrading the blower motor - on my Goodman furnace( imported from US )

It's a 4 speed 1/3 HP motor.

I'm thinking about putting Azure ECM motor, apparently it auto setups CFM.

But I would like to verify that it's correct what tools do I need beside manometer ? To measure static pressure.

ECM motors take a special board to regulate it's speed. You cannot just replace the motor from a standard multi speed motor sometimes called X13 motors. ECM motors are quite good when it is designed into the air handler but it take a new computer board to run it. A 0-12 volt dc output to the motor determines the speed but the controller card alone with other factors determines the speed. Also, the thermostat needs to be proprietary where you can read air static pressure and fan RPM's.

If you found this and it is why you want to change it, your not buying any more efficiently. It will just complicate the install and any future motor replacement by someone not familiar with it.

I maintained a church that had eight Carrier AC units with ECM motors in the air handler and the condenser cooling fan. there was a very high failure rate and it was very expensive. In seven years three blower motors went bad and two condenser fans. On a third outside unit the control card for the ECM motor went bad. Another very expensive part. all of these motors were GENTEC's (formerly GE motors).
